St Osyth
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ia.

St Osyth is a village in North East Essex in the south east of the United Kingdom. It is about five miles from Clacton-on-Sea, and about twelve miles from Colchester. It is located on the B1027.

Point Clear is an area of the village, located to west of the village centre.

St Osyth is a parish of Tendring District.

Local Sights

The most notable building in the village is undoubtedly its medieval Priory. The village church is dedicated to St Peter and St Paul.
